An update to Redsn0w 0.9.6 iOS 4.3.1 jailbreak has been released which is said to fix “any lingering issues with the boot animation”. Still Sn0wbreeze 2.5.1 for Windows can also be used to enable customized  animated boot logos on iPhone, iPad and iPod touch.   Those of you who are already jailbroken on iOS 4.3.1 using Redsn0w 0.9.6rc9, rc10 or rc11 can simply rerun Redsn0w 0.9.6rc12 over the existing jailbreak by selecting “Allow boot animation” option as shown in the

Can Apple Achieve a Retina Display on the iPad?

When Apple adopted the retina display on the iPhone 4 last June, they made arguably one of the best computing displays every created. Simply the amount of pixels they are able to pack into a small 3.5-inch display is remarkable. The term retina was used because the pixels are packed so tightly, most human eyes cannot see them. This makes reading text much more pleasurable and renders photos and webpages with amazing detail. There is no doubt Apple wants to put a retina display on the iPad. It

Apple: New Multitouch Gesture Not for Public Consumption

Those looking forward to the new multi-touch gestures in the forthcoming iOS 4.3 for the iPad are in for a disappointment. In the release notes of the latest version, iOS 4.3 beta 2, Apple has made clear that the four and five-finger gestures that appeared in the first beta are merely for testing purposes. They won’t make it into the final version. This beta release contains a preview of new multitasking gestures for iPad. You can use four or five fingers to pinch to the Home Screen, swipe
